El Golea vs Chateau Tongariro Climate & Distance Between

New Zealand flag
  • The distance between El Golea, Algeria and Chateau Tongariro, New Zealand is approximately 18,846 km or 11,711 mi.
  • To reach El Golea in this distance one would set out from Chateau Tongariro bearing 217°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ach El Golea bearing 327.2° or NNW .
  • El Golea has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Chateau Tongariro has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• El Golea is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Chateau Tongariro is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 14.1 °C (25.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.4 °C (24.1°F) more in El Golea.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2908.8 mm (114.5 in) less which is equivalent to 2908.8 l/m² (71.39 US gal/ft²) or 29,088,000 l/ha (3,109,700 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.3° higher in El Golea than in Chateau Tongariro.
  • Relative humidity levels are 50.5%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 2°C (3.7°F) lower.
